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:

  • Inspects guestrooms to ensure the highest cleaning standards are met.
  • Provides counseling and supports team members in meeting their responsibilities and becoming part of the team.
  • Interviews applicants and hires qualified candidates.
  • Executes and issues notices of disciplinary action.
  • Ensures all team members follow hotel policies and procedures.
  • Expedites and oversees special requests from the Front Desk.
  • Attends management meetings.
  • Develops teams and its members.
  • Motivates employees to provide superior customer service to our guests.
  • Monitors job performance daily.

Qualifications:

  • Previous supervisory experience is required.
  • Strong written and verbal skills are required.
  • Excellent interpersonal, customer service, organizational, team building, and problem solving skills are required.
  • Knowledge of the Culinary Bargaining Agreement is preferred.
  • Must demonstrate the ability to lead, guide, direct, develop, and motivate people at all levels.
  • Must possess strong people skills with ability to problem solve through listening and responding to the needs of team members.
  • Knowledge of Housekeeping operation is necessary.
  • Knowledge of computers and typing skills are essential.
  • Must have a good understanding and working knowledge of chemical and cleaning supplies and techniques/equipment, including SDS and OSHA guidelines would be beneficial.
  • Must be able to converse, understand, read, and write in English.
  • Must be able to calmly handle all situations.
  • Must be willing to work any day of the week and any shift when required.
  • Must be able to get along well with coworkers and work as a team.
  • Must present a well-groomed appearance.
